How to rank in Google Maps in Kuala Lumpur

Three businesses appear in the map pack. Everyone else is a tap away, which in practice means invisible. Here is what decides the three.

Short answer

Google weighs three things: proximity to the searcher, relevance of your profile and site to the query, and prominence, meaning how well known you appear to be. You cannot change proximity. Why KL is a harder map market than it looks

Klang Valley density works against you. In Bangsar, Mont Kiara or Bukit Bintang there may be thirty comparable businesses inside a three kilometre radius. Proximity is doing enormous work, and the results a customer sees in Damansara are not the results they see in Cheras.

That has a practical consequence. Checking your own ranking from your own office tells you almost nothing, because you are standing at the point of maximum proximity advantage. Check from where your customers actually are.

It also means a single profile cannot cover the Klang Valley. If you serve the whole area from one address, you need service-area pages doing the work the profile cannot. That is what the areas we serve structure is for.

Method

The work, in order of impact

Fix the primary category first

The single highest-leverage field on the profile, and the most commonly wrong. Pick the most specific category that matches your main revenue, not the broadest one. Add secondary categories for everything else.

Make the name, address and phone identical everywhere

Your site, your profile, every directory, your invoices. Malaysian address formatting is inconsistent enough that this drifts on its own. Contradiction dilutes prominence.

Build a steady review flow, not a burst

Twenty reviews in one week looks manufactured. Two or three a week for a year is a signal. Ask at the moment the customer is happiest, and reply to every one, including the bad ones.

Load the profile fully

Services with descriptions, products, real photos with real filenames, opening hours including public holidays, and the questions section seeded with genuine questions you actually get.

Build location relevance on the website

The map pack reads your site too. A page that genuinely covers the suburb, with local specifics rather than a find-and-replace of the town name, supports the profile.

Earn local prominence off-site

Mentions from Malaysian directories, industry bodies, local press and community sites. This is the slow compounding part, and it is what separates the top three from positions four to ten.

Common faults

Why your competitor outranks you from further away

If someone further from the searcher is beating you, prominence or relevance is doing it. Usually one of these.

  • Their primary category is more specific than yours.
  • They have more reviews, arriving more steadily, with replies on all of them.
  • Their reviews contain the words people search for, because they ask customers to describe the job rather than just rate it.
  • Their profile is completely filled in and yours is at about sixty percent.
  • They have a real page for that service in that area. You have one page listing twelve services and nine suburbs.
  • They are cited on Malaysian directories and local publications and you are not.

Questions

Google Maps questions

Do I need a physical KL address to rank in the map pack?

You need a genuine address Google can verify, and it must be a real place where you do business. Virtual offices and mailbox addresses carry real suspension risk. A service-area business without a storefront can hide the address and still rank, but the service area must be honest.

Can I have more than one profile for one business?

One per genuine physical location, each with its own staff and its own hours. Creating extra profiles to cover more of the Klang Valley is a suspension risk, and the recovery process is slow and unpleasant.

How much do reviews actually matter?

A great deal, and the pattern matters as much as the count. Steady arrival, recent dates, owner replies, and review text containing the service and the location. Never buy them. Malaysian review fraud is easier to detect than people assume and the penalty lands on you.
